
Chiefs of the Sovereign First Nations of Treaty No. 8 Condemn Bill C-5
The Chiefs of the Sovereign First Nations of Treaty 8 have released a statement condemning Bill C-5.
Legislation introduced under the bill would allow for the fast-tracking of resource development projects under the label of national interest.
The leaders of the Treaty 8 First Nations of Alberta argue Ottawa bypassed First Nations when drafting the bill, and is accusing the government of overreach, constitutional neglect, and treaty violations.
Grand Chief Trevor Mercredi says the bill demonstrates a strategy of imposing poly on Treaty people that would take years to fight in court.
